REST Resource: projects.apps.releases

Recurso: Release

Uma versão de um app do Firebase.

Representação JSON
{
  "name": string,
  "releaseNotes": {
    object (ReleaseNotes)
  },
  "displayVersion": string,
  "buildVersion": string,
  "createTime": string,
  "firebaseConsoleUri": string,
  "testingUri": string,
  "binaryDownloadUri": string
}
Campos
name

string

O nome do recurso de lançamento.

Formato: projects/{projectNumber}/apps/{appId}/releases/{releaseId}

releaseNotes

object (ReleaseNotes)

Notas de lançamento.

displayVersion

string

Apenas saída. Exibir a versão do lançamento. Para uma versão do Android, a versão de exibição é versionName. Para uma versão do iOS, a versão de exibição é CFBundleShortVersionString.

buildVersion

string

Apenas saída. Versão de build do lançamento. Para uma versão do Android, a versão do build é versionCode. Para uma versão do iOS, a versão do build é CFBundleVersion.

createTime

string (Timestamp format)

Apenas saída. A hora em que a versão foi criada.

Um carimbo de data/hora no formato RFC3339 UTC "Zulu", com resolução de nanossegundos e até nove dígitos fracionários. Exemplos: "2014-10-02T15:01:23Z" e "2014-10-02T15:01:23.045123456Z".

firebaseConsoleUri

string

Apenas saída. Um link para o Console do Firebase mostrando uma única versão.

testingUri

string

Apenas saída. Um link para a versão no clipe da Web ou no app Android do testador que permite aos testadores (que têm acesso ao app) ver as notas da versão e instalar o app nos próprios dispositivos.

binaryDownloadUri

string

Apenas saída. Um link assinado (que expira em uma hora) para fazer o download direto do arquivo binário do app (IPA/APK/AAB).

Notas de lançamento

Notas que pertencem a uma versão.

Representação JSON
{
  "text": string
}
Campos
text

string

Texto das notas da versão.

Métodos

batchDelete

Exclui versões.

distribute

Distribui uma versão para os testadores.

get

Recebe uma versão.

list

Lista as versões.

patch

Atualiza uma versão.